In this month's episode, and the last episode for Series 2, Holly Barradell is in conversation with Dr Krystal Wilkinson and Caroline Biddle. "What do we really know about family formation?" and how can we educate and empower people to understand more about the work life interface, the complex journey of fertility and how can we raise awareness with different stakeholder groups? Through Drama - well Ethnodrama to be specific. This episode discusses the huge challenges people face when faced with infertility and Caroline Biddle, a former Drama teacher herself now turned Fertility coach and fertility workplace consultant supports teachers specifically facing infertility and the upheaval this brings to their personal and professional lives. Listen in and find out more about pronatalism in the teaching profession and how ethnodrama gives a creative platform to disseminate research findings.
